
Skills you'll gain: Unity Engine, User Interface (UI), Debugging, User Interface (UI) Design, Game Design, Video Game Development, User Interface and User Experience (UI/UX) Design, Frontend Integration, 3D Assets, Program Development, Interactive Design, Virtual Environment, Scripting, C# (Programming Language), Development Testing
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Unity Engine, C# (Programming Language), Android Development, Mobile Development, Scripting, Video Game Development, Game Design, User Interface (UI), Application Deployment
Advanced · Course · 1 - 3 Months

Skills you'll gain: Object Oriented Design, Development Environment, Code Reusability, Data Management, Scalability, Performance Tuning, Memory Management
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Interactive Design, File I/O, Computer Graphic Techniques, Memory Management
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Unreal Engine, Unity Engine, 3D Assets, Video Game Development, Software Installation, Game Design, Development Environment, User Interface (UI), Cross Platform Development, Scripting
★ 4.9 (11) ·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Unity Engine, Video Game Development, Version Control, Mobile Development, Android Development, Android (Operating System), User Interface (UI) Design, User Interface (UI), C# (Programming Language), UI Components, Game Design, Git (Version Control System), Animation and Game Design, Release Management, Scripting, Animations
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Unity Engine, Animation and Game Design, Animations, Video Game Development, Game Design, Computer Graphics
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Code Reusability, Software Architecture, Object Oriented Design, Data-oriented programming, C# (Programming Language), Memory Management, Artificial Intelligence
Intermediate · Course · 1 - 3 Months

Fudan University
Skills you'll gain: Unity Engine, Animation and Game Design, User Interface (UI), Mobile Development, Video Game Development, C# (Programming Language), User Interface (UI) Design, 3D Assets, Game Design, UI Components, Animations, Mobile Development Tools, Application Deployment, Programming Principles, Scripting, Computer Graphics, Cross Platform Development, Object Oriented Programming (OOP), Development Environment
★ 4.7 (100) · Beginner · Course · 1 - 3 Months

University of Colorado System
Skills you'll gain: Video Game Development, Game Design, Unity Engine, C++ (Programming Language), Programming Principles, Object Oriented Programming (OOP), Code Reusability, C# (Programming Language), Maintainability, Computational Logic, Data Structures, Computer Programming
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Animations, Computer Graphic Techniques, Game Design, Creative Design, Digital Publishing, Data Import/Export
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Unity Engine, Game Design, Animation and Game Design, Video Game Development, Virtual Environment, Animations, User Interface (UI), UI Components, User Interface (UI) Design, Program Development, Debugging, Scripting, C# (Programming Language)
★ 5 (18) · Mixed · Course · 1 - 4 Weeks